“Did the condom really break all those years back or did you just want to baby trap me, Varian?” He looked at me, eyes freezing over, “I just did what time you would make sure you would never leave my side,” ••••••••••••• Varian and Thalia had been childhood sweethearts ever since they were little. He was the alpha son and she came from the Beta line, there's seemed like a perfect love story just waiting for its happy ending. That was until Thalia got a scholarship to go to Crescent University and pursue her dream of becoming a professional healer, it was supposed to mark the end of their relationship until another curveball was thrown at them–Thalia’s pregnancy. Her dream was eventually flushed down the toilet, exchanged for being an underappreciated glorified housewife with the title of Luna slapped across it. Varian had become distant over the years then the straw that broke the camel's back was when she found out that he had been cheating with her best friend, devastation claimed her. She demanded for a divorce and as if to punish her he made sure she was left with nothing more than the clothes on her back. One night she disappeared with her twins, and years passed. Varian came face-to-face with her again. The only woman who could cure a plague unlike any seen in a hundred years. He tried to win her back but now saw that their twins was calling another man ‘Daddy’
